在LinkedList中打印输入的内容,可以通过遍历LinkedList的每个节点,并将节点的值打印出来实现。以下是一个示例代码:
import java.util.LinkedList;
public class LinkedListPrinter {
public static void main(String[] args) {
LinkedList<String> linkedList = new LinkedList<>();
linkedList.add("Hello");
linkedList.add("World");
linkedList.add("!");
printLinkedList(linkedList);
}
public static void printLinkedList(LinkedList<String> linkedList) {
for (String value : linkedList) {
System.out.println(value);
}
}
}
这段代码创建了一个LinkedList对象,并向其中添加了三个字符串元素。然后调用printLinkedList方法,该方法通过for-each循环遍历LinkedList中的每个元素,并使用System.out.println方法将其打印出来。
LinkedList是一种双向链表数据结构,它的优势在于插入和删除元素的效率较高。它适用于需要频繁进行插入和删除操作的场景,例如实现队列或栈等数据结构。
腾讯云提供了云计算相关的产品,例如云服务器、云数据库、云存储等。您可以访问腾讯云官网了解更多关于这些产品的详细信息:腾讯云产品
领取专属 10元无门槛券
手把手带您无忧上云